Output 42fb68461d0b51ba16fc4f42df42edb8be2bd4e80f9afd5d0d6eae445d74e619:0

value
279157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 250d760176786ebe7b6844c4d380fc7191a9ed0c OP_EQUAL
address
354w3vdBL9jM8L1hCV3dDkeAvZdADzcjRs
transaction
42fb68461d0b51ba16fc4f42df42edb8be2bd4e80f9afd5d0d6eae445d74e619
spent
true